A holiday ornament in the shape of a square pyramid has the following dimensions 2.75 * 2.75 * 2.75 in. What is the approximate volume of the ornament

The volume of a square pyramid can be calculated using the formula V = (1/3) * b * h, where b is the area of the base and h is the height of the pyramid.
In this case, the base of the square pyramid has sides of length 2.75 inches, so the area of the base would be 2.75 * 2.75 = 7.5625 square inches.
The height of the pyramid is also given as 2.75 inches.
Substituting these values into the formula, we get:
V = (1/3) * 7.5625 * 2.75 ≈ 6.58 cubic inches.
Therefore, the approximate volume of the ornament is 6.58 cubic inches.
